Simon, what about the back brake lever? Yes, I bent it over a fire extinguisher. It passes through a hollow shaft with bronze bushes to the opposite side to align with the brake and pivot as close to the swingarm pivot as possible to prevent brake grab when the rear wheel is bouncing over bumps. Explain the lines. It's the oil pump with scavenge adapter. Oil comes from the tank to the feed side 7 of the pump. Then is distributed to the crank and valve box. It makes it's own way through the engine to the crank cases where the scavenge adapter picks it up and returns it back to the tank. The scavenge is twice as efficient as the feed to prevent wet sumping whilst running.
